China appreciates Russian President Vladimir Putin’s viewpoint that attempts to contain China and Russia are a grave mistake, Chinese Foreign Ministry Spokesperson Geng Shuang told reporters at a press briefing on Friday, commenting on the Russian leader’s statement, Eurasia Diary reports citing Tass news.
We attach great importance to the positive and clear stance expressed by President Putin. Some countries have recently adhered to the principles of unilateralism and meddled in other states’ domestic affairs, using the sanctions mechanism, which affects the existing world order and undermines the basis of the current international relations system," he said.
"This practice is backward movement and a grave mistake, which [the international community] does not welcome," the diplomat added.
"China and Russia are permanent members of the UN Security Council and major developing countries. Both countries seek to protect national sovereignty and security, and the basic principles of international law," the spokesperson stressed. "We have common interests and needs, so we share responsibility for maintaining global peace and stability and for upholding justice and honesty in international relations."
